0) The event contains loops. It is better to generate events with Sherpa
with HEPMC_TREE_LIKE=1 or so. See docs.  Have you used it?


1)
On Tue, 2017-11-14 at 16:43 +0000, Andy Buckley wrote:
> Hi Andrii,
> 
> If the particle status codes are not 1 or 2, there is no guarantee
> that HepMC vertices correspond to physical processes. They may just be
> bookkeeping devices, e.g. to absorb parton shower recoils (or in this
> case perhaps the QED radiation treatment) -- this wouldn't be a Sherpa
> bug, but a valid use of the freedoms in the HepMC standard. So we
> can't have projection code that assumes particular vertex structures,
> because there will always be such edge-cases.

In general you are right, but not for electron in DIS that is coming
from hard process. The only thing one expects from it is e->e+gamma  or
e-> W nu ( not in Rivet anyway). But no hadronisation vertices.


Sherpa mixes everything together, in one vertex.
I haven't said that is a bug, but a *problem*. A problem for kinematics
reconstruction.




> Can you explain what the logic of your DIS lepton finder is? (The code
> is not super-easy to follow.) Hopefully an understanding of the
> intention will help us to find a safer definition.

The logic comes from  DIS definition: scattered lepton is the beam
electron that went through e->e gamma/Z0 or e-> W nu vertices.

> >> > Dear rivet authors,
> >> >
> >> > I think I found a bug in the DISLepton class in rivet version 2.5.4: It does
> >> > not find the outgoing lepton for a DIS scattering generated with Sherpa (the
> >> > corresponding HepMC file is attached).
> >> >
> >> > As far as I understand it in DISLepton::project the iteration over all
> >> > vertices and fails on the vertex "-6", because there are two outgoing
> >> > leptons ("10009" and "10015"). The first electron loops over vertex "-5"
> >> > back into vertex "-6" (for what ever reason), so it is not an actual final
> >> > state particle. The old code from version 2.5.3 does actually work for the
> >> > event.
